What affects the price

When you look at the cost of getting an EV charger installed at your home, a few main things change the bottom line. The biggest factor is how far your electrical panel is from where you want the charger; longer wiring runs mean more materials and labor. You also have to consider if your current panel has enough available amperage to handle the new circuit, or if you need an expensive service upgrade. Additionally, the type of charger you choose and the difficulty of running conduit through walls or attics play a role.

What is involved in installing a Level 2 charger at a home in Sunrise?

Installing a Level 2 charger at your Sunrise residence begins with a thorough site assessment to determine the optimal location and necessary electrical upgrades. Pros will verify your existing electrical panel can safely accommodate a dedicated 240V circuit, typically requiring a 30-60 amp breaker. They then run the appropriate wiring, using correctly sized conductors and conduit, to the charger's placement. Finally, the charger is securely mounted and connected. This ensures a safe, code-compliant, and efficient charging setup for your electric vehicle.

How do EV charging stations differ from standard outlets for electric cars?

EV charging stations, particularly Level 2 models, provide a dedicated 240-volt connection, significantly faster than a standard 120-volt household outlet. This higher voltage and amperage deliver a more robust and efficient charge, reducing vehicle downtime. Unlike a standard outlet, a Level 2 charger is hardwired or connected to a specific circuit designed for its power draw, ensuring safety and preventing overloading.
